Profile
Generates subscription revenue from a cloud work-management platform for projects, goals, workflows, and AI-agent coordination. Revenue is more concentrated in the United States than international markets, and operations are disclosed as one reportable segment.
Generates subscription revenue from a cloud work-management platform that organizes projects, goals, workflows, collaboration, and coordination for teams. Current product lines include the core seat-based platform, AI Teammates, AI Studio, Asana Dash, MCP and AI Connectors, and StackAI by Asana.
Serves paying customers across many countries, with revenue more concentrated in the United States than international markets. Its disclosed operating view is a single reportable segment rather than separate product or geography segments.
Executes around clarity of work, shared accountability, and workflow governance, extending its Work Graph from human coordination into agentic work. The business operates in a fragmented market shaped by productivity suites, specialist work-management tools, vertical workflow software, AI-assisted customer discovery, and founder-affiliate voting control.

Peers
- Atlassian
Broad teamwork platform overlap across Jira, Confluence, and AI agents
- monday.com
Direct AI work-platform rival in projects, workflows, CRM, service, and dev
- Microsoft
Suite rival through Microsoft 365, Teams, Power Platform, and Copilot
- ServiceNow
Enterprise workflow platform rival in service, IT, process, and AI agents
- Salesforce
Workflow and collaboration overlap through Slack, Agentforce, and low-code tools
- Workday
Vertical enterprise workflow rival around people, finance, planning, and agents
